Wassailing

On Monday, we went to the Orange Peel Morris annual Wassailing at Spirit Tree Cidery, Ontario.

[image error] [image error]

It was a beautiful clear day, and got clearer and less cloudy as the day went on. The wassailers sang the Carhampton Wassail Song to awaken the trees, we dipped toast in cider and hung it on the branches, and there was lots of Morris dancing. I had a go and joined in with a dance called Tinner’s Rabbit.
